DHAKA, Oct 07, 2019 (BSS) – The Bangladesh Meteorological Department (BMD)
predicted light to moderate rain or thunder showers at many places of the
country in the next 24 hours commencing at 9am today.

“Light to moderate rain or thunder showers accompanied by temporary gusty
wind is likely to occur at a few places over Khulna, Barishal, Chattogram,
Mymensingh and Sylhet divisions and at one or two places over Rangpur,
Rajshahi and Dhaka divisions with moderately heavy falls at some places of
the country”, said a BMD bulletin.

“Monsoon is less active over Bangladesh and weak over North Bay”, it
added.

However, the day and night temperature may remain nearly unchanged over
the country.

The highest temperature on Sunday was recorded 34.0 degrees Celsius in
Rajshahi, Ishurdi, Tarash in Rajshahi division and Chuadanga in Khulna
division, while today’s minimum temperature is 22.6 degrees Celsius in
Gopalgonj under Dhaka division.

The highest rainfall for the last 24 hours till 6am was recorded 41
millimeters (mm) at Madaripur under Dhaka division.

The sun sets at 5:40pm today and rises at 5:53am tomorrow in Dhaka.
